The Jewellery Quarter in Birmingham

The Jewellery Quarter in Birmingham

 In 1998, the city council adopted a framework plan for the future development of Birmingham's Jewellery Quarter. This plan used mixed-use development and community-based design to promote the future of Birmingham's jewellery quarter. The plan was prepared by a team of consultants led by EDAW Ltd., commissioned by Birmingham City Council and English Partnerships. The Birmingham Jewellery Quarter Urban Village Framework Plan is one of several plans produced by the Birmingham City Council and its partners.

Conservation measures

 The current focus of the Birmingham jewellery quarter is on developing it as a creative enterprise centre, rather than a jewellers' quarter. The city has been working to attract private investment in the area through business rate relief and other incentives. A major project is currently underway to turn the former A.E. Harris jewellery factory into a dual-purpose industrial facility, which may include a museum and medical centre. These measures are designed to preserve the unique character of the Quarter while encouraging economic development.

 Several years ago, the city council commissioned a survey of the Jewellery Quarter and subsequently adopted a framework plan that uses mixed-use development, a community-led approach, and innovative approaches to regeneration. The project's first phase involved the training of twenty volunteers in the architecture of the Jewellery Quarter and recording the conditions of historic buildings. The training material was tested by volunteers, who conducted the survey independently. Once the volunteers had completed the surveys, specialist staff moderated each survey and gave feedback.
